About the Author
Dr. Lois Nightingale is a Clinical Psychologist, a licensed Marriage, Family and Child Therapist, as well as an author, popular national speaker and storyteller. She is the director of the Nightingale Counseling Center in Yorba Linda, California and the mother of two children. Dr. Nightingale is also the author of Overcoming Postpartum Depression, A Doctor's Own Story, and My Parents Still Love Me Even Though They're Getting Divorced, An Interactive Tale for Children. She was the director of the New Mothers Counseling Center from 1990 to 1993, and pioneered an inpatient hospital program to treat new mothers without seperating them from their babies. She has taken a special interest in helping new mothers adjust to motherhood and bring peace into their homes.
